What Are Casinos Not on Gamestop
Casinos not on Gamestop refer to online gambling sites that accept players from the UK but are not connected to the Gamestop self-exclusion scheme. Gamestop is a government-backed program designed to help players control their gambling by allowing them to self-exclude from all UK-licensed gambling websites. When a player opts into Gamestop, they cannot access any participating site for a set period.
Casinos not on Gamestop typically hold licenses from jurisdictions like Curacao, Malta, or Gibraltar. Since they are not regulated by the UK Gambling Commission, they are not required to participate in the Gamestop program. This means that even players who have self-excluded through Gamestop can still access these casinos.

Risks Associated with Casinos Not on Gamestop
Despite their advantages, casinos not on Gamestop carry risks. Because they are not regulated by the UK Gambling Commission, players have fewer protections. There may be issues with unclear terms and conditions, delayed payments, or poor customer support.
Players who have chosen to self-exclude via Gamestop often do so because they want to manage gambling addiction or problematic behavior. Using casinos not on Gamestop to bypass self-exclusion can worsen these issues. Many of these casinos lack strong responsible gambling tools, making it easier to develop harmful habits.
